Free credit monitoring from TransUnion

Source: Michelle Singletary, Washington Post (Free Registration)

In a class-action settlement, the credit bureau TransUnion has agreed to provide free credit-monitoring services to millions of consumers to settle claims that it illegally passed along private information for marketing purposes.

Although TransUnion denied any wrongdoing, the settlement requires the company to sign up consumers for either six months or nine months of monitoring.

Unless you’ve been a conscientious objector to all forms of borrowing in the last 21 years, you’re probably eligible for the monitoring service. But the deadline to sign up is fast approaching. You have until Sept. 24 to register for benefits under the settlement.
